Remodel Bathroom: Elevate Function and Style
Transforming your bathroom begins with prioritizing both form and function. Incorporate features like walk-in showers, premium tile work, and smart storage to maximize space. Opt for energy-efficient lighting and ventilation to ensure comfort and sustainability. Modern vanities and accessible design not only elevate appearance but also cater to long-term usability for all household members.
Laundry Room Makeover: Practicality Meets Innovation
A renovated laundry room blends convenience with clean design. Install custom cabinets with ample shelf space and built-in laundry carts to streamline chores. Upgrade to quiet, durable appliances and consider moisture-resistant materials to protect against spills. Adding a small seating nook or ambient lighting turns the space into a functional workflow zone—and a more pleasant environment overall.
